There is no official version of for the PSP or PPSSPP emulator. While you may see titles claiming to be "Free Fire PPSSPP ISO," these are usually "modded" versions of older PSP games like Grand Theft Auto or Counter-Strike that have been customized to look like Free Fire.

Because Free Fire is a modern online-only mobile game, a real ISO would not be able to connect to official servers. For a legitimate experience, you should use the following officially supported methods: Official Ways to Play Free Fire

Android & iOS: Download the official app from the Google Play Store or Apple App Store.

PC via Official Emulator: Garena supports playing on PC using the Google Play Games Beta.

PC via Third-Party Emulators: Many players use Android emulators designed for PC, such as:

BlueStacks: Popular for its customizable keyboard mapping and performance. Free Fire PPSSPP ISO ROM Zip File Download High...

GameLoop: Developed by Tencent and optimized for mobile shooters.

LDPlayer: A lightweight option good for mid-range or lower-end PCs.

There is no official Free Fire PPSSPP because Garena Free Fire is a modern mobile game and was never released for the PlayStation Portable (PSP) console. Files labeled as "Free Fire PPSSPP" are typically unofficial mods or fan-made versions. Google Play Understanding "Free Fire PPSSPP" Files Unofficial Mods: These are usually other PSP games (like GTA: Vice City Stories

) that have been modified with Free Fire-style textures, skins, and menus. Offline Fan Games:

Some developers create small, offline "Free Fire Lite" versions for emulators, but these do not have official support or the full online multiplayer features of the original game. Security Risks:

Be cautious when downloading ISO or ZIP files from unofficial sources, as they may contain malware or viruses. Recommended Ways to Play Free Fire
